Make fuzz autodetect file names
e.g. out/ASAN/fuzz -b /path/to/file Bug: skia: Change-Id: I6df370a7f83e8ea8fc8c2dec20834620bc726911 Reviewed-on: https://skia-review.googlesource.com/122901 Reviewed-by: Mike Klein <mtklein@google.com> Commit-Queue: Kevin Lubick <kjlubick@google.com>

+static std::map<std::string, std::string> cf_api_map = {
+ {"api_draw_functions", "DrawFunctions"},
+ {"api_gradients", "Gradients"},
+ {"api_image_filter", "ImageFilter"},
+ {"api_mock_gpu_canvas", "MockGPUCanvas"},
+ {"api_null_canvas", "NullCanvas"},
+ {"api_path_measure", "PathMeasure"},
+ {"api_raster_n32_canvas", "RasterN32Canvas"},
+ {"jpeg_encoder", "JPEGEncoder"},
+ {"png_encoder", "PNGEncoder"},
+ {"webp_encoder", "WEBPEncoder"}
+};
+
+static std::map<std::string, std::string> cf_map = {
+ {"animated_image_decode", "animated_image_decode"},
+ {"image_decode", "image_decode"},
+ {"image_filter_deserialize", "filter_fuzz"},
+ {"image_filter_deserialize_width", "filter_fuzz"},
+ {"path_deserialize", "path_deserialize"},
+ {"region_deserialize", "region_deserialize"},
+ {"region_set_path", "region_set_path"},
+ {"textblob_deserialize", "textblob"}
+};
+
+static SkString try_auto_detect(SkString path, SkString* name) {
+ std::cmatch m;
+ std::regex clusterfuzz("clusterfuzz-testcase(-minimized)?-([a-z0-9_]+)-[\\d]+");
+ std::regex skiafuzzer("(api-)?(\\w+)-[a-f0-9]+");
+
+ if (std::regex_search(path.c_str(), m, clusterfuzz)) {
+ std::string type = m.str(2);
+ if (type.find("api_") != std::string::npos || type.find("_encoder") != std::string::npos) {
+ if (cf_api_map.find(type) != cf_api_map.end()) {
+ *name = SkString(cf_api_map[type].c_str()); //probably wrong
+ return SkString("api");
+ } else {
+ SkDebugf("Unrecognized api name %s\n", type.c_str());
+ print_api_names();
+ return SkString("");
+ }
+ } else {
+ if (cf_map.find(type) != cf_map.end()) {
+ return SkString(cf_map[type].c_str());
+ }
+ }
+ } else if (std::regex_search(path.c_str(), m, skiafuzzer)) {
+ std::string a1 = m.str(1);
+ std::string typeOrName = m.str(2);
+ if (a1.length() > 0) {
+ // it's an api fuzzer
+ *name = SkString(typeOrName.c_str());
+ return SkString("api");
+ } else {
+ return SkString(typeOrName.c_str());
+ }
+ }
+
+ return SkString("");
+}
